About PARC: Since opening in 2015, PARC has become the destination in the Plymouth Community to experience theater, art, music, dance, culinary, education, fitness, and recreation programs for all ages provide by over 50 organizations that call PARC their home. PARC also rents its facilities, including a large gymnasium, as well as smaller meeting rooms to individuals or organizations for performances or events from athletic practices and competitions to special occasions like banquets or class reunions.
